Cibo Divino at Sylvan Thirty opens for breakfast, lunch and dinner today. Also, pizza, local craft beer and hundreds of bottles of wine.

Husband-and-wife owners Daniele and Christina Puleo live in Kessler Park and contrived the concept for their restaurant and market one night after Christina had a hard time finding a good bottle of wine close to home.

Cibo Divino has a pizza oven ordered from Naples, prepared sandwiches and salads, cheeses, olives and salumi, as well as espresso drinks and breakfasts.
